What is the name of Koumbia's airport?
Koumbia is served by just one airport, Bobo Dioulasso Airport (BOY).
What airport is best to fly into Koumbia?
Step through the exit of Bobo Dioulasso Airport and your Koumbia trip will have begun! The city's main airport, it's located 45 mi from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Koumbia?
With only one airline flying to Koumbia, choice may be limited. It's a good idea to book your tickets well in advance.
How many nonstop flights are there to Koumbia?
Flying to a new place is much simpler when there aren't any stopovers to slow you down. If you're making your way to Koumbia, the fantastic news is that there are around 7 direct flights operating every week.
Where are the most popular flights to Koumbia departing from?
Both Ouagadougou and Abidjan airports operate a large number of flights to Koumbia.
How long is the flight to Koumbia Airport?
From the moment you leave the ground in Ouagadougou, you'll be midair for somewhere around 50 minutes before you arrive at the terminal in Koumbia. Jet-setters coming in from Abidjan can expect to be on the flight for around 1 hour and 15 minutes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Squeeze all your full-sized bottles of hair gel and hairspray in your checked baggage. Any gels or li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by authorities. Sharp or pointed objects, like your trusty Swiss Army knife, and dangerous goods which are explosive or flammable, such as aerosol cans, spray paint and poisons, are also not allowed.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should always be your priority when selecting what to wear during your flight. Consider your footwear with care too, as swelling of the feet and ankles are a common occurrence. Slightly roomy, flat shoes are always a good idea.
  • The result of sustained peri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clotting condition that can affect passengers on long-distance flights. But the great news is there are numerous ways to lower your risk of developing it. Stay well hydrated, walk up and down the aisles as much as possible and wear compression socks or tights.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Koumbia?
Being organized before you arrive at the airport can make your trip to Koumbia a breeze. Check out our handy hints for a stress-free journey past security:

  • Your travel documents and ID will need to be presented to airport security personnel. Have them easily accessible so you don't hold up the line.
  • The X-ray machine is up next. Remove anything metal on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es items like earphones or headph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• For just a few moments, you'll need to unplug from technology. Your laptop, phone and any other electronic devices also need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Remove all gels and liquids from your carry-on lu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ray machine separately. Each product should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it inside a single quart-size (one liter),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a sensible footwear choice as you're less likely to have to remove them when passing through security. Safety boots and other heavy-style sh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Airlines will not allow any pocket knives or other sharp items to come on board with you.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ked baggage.
